1. What is Square Footage?

Square footage is a measurement of area, specifically the area of a two-dimensional space measured in square feet. It's commonly used in real estate, construction, and interior design to quantify the size of rooms, buildings, or properties.

3. Importance of Square Footage Calculation

Details: Accurate square footage calculations are essential for determining material quantities, space planning, property valuation, and compliance with building codes.

4. Using the Calculator

Tips: Measure the length and width of the room in feet, enter both values. All values must be positive numbers. For irregularly shaped rooms, divide into rectangular sections.

5.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q1: How do I measure irregularly shaped rooms?
A: Divide the space into rectangular sections, calculate each separately, then sum the areas.

Q2: Should I include closets in room measurements?
A: Yes, include all contiguous floor space within the room's perimeter.

Q3: How precise should my measurements be?
A: For most purposes, measuring to the nearest inch (0.08 feet) is sufficient.

Q4: Does this work for metric measurements?
A: No, this calculates square feet. For square meters, convert measurements first (1 ft = 0.3048 m).

Q5: How does ceiling height affect square footage?
A: Square footage measures floor area only. For volume (cubic feet), multiply by ceiling height.
